Led by Helicopter Association International (HAI) Tour Operators Committee, the Tour Operators Program of Safety (TOPS) forum is open to all interested air tour operators. The meeting will discuss topics relevant to tour operators across the country, such as FAA regulations, TOPS safety audits and TOPS requirements, with safety as the main focus. Learn more about what TOPS members are doing in New York, Alaska, The Grand Canyon, Las Vegas, and the Hawaiian island to reduce risk and raise the safety bar!
